Sirens Studio SIRENS Studio is a gender inclusive recording studio based at Fish Factory Arts Penryn.

This Friday we are joined by who will be presenting her debut EP From The Understory, which explores our evolutionary journey and interconnectedness with plant life through vocal harmonies, electronics and analogue textures. The music was developed as part of Alice’s residency at the Eden Project, Cornwall – home to the world’s largest indoor rainforest.

Alice is joined by artists Dazey, zha and Jacob Norris, who together sing harmonies inspired by groups such as Dirty Projectors and Deep Throat Choir. The pieces will be woven together with interludes by writer Natasha Kaeda, whose storytelling will explore our relationship with the ecosystems we live in.

Ava (Jamie) Elless (they/she) is a composer, researcher-designer, performer and artist from Birmingham. Her music often blends alternative and experimental notation practices with graphic design principles and q***r liberation politics. She draws inspiration from medieval European music, worldwide folk traditions, ambient and drone music, natural acoustic phenomena, and sonic storytelling. Primarily a violist, keyboardist, vocalist and bassist, her debut EP ‘string music’ is due to be released in late-Spring 2023. K.óla is the solo project of Katrín Helga Ólafsdóttir from Iceland and is our second residency artist of 2023!

Since 2017, Katrín has been releasing music and making art under the name K.óla, creating songs that contain playful melodies and sincere lyrics. She is currently living in Copenhagen, studying Music Creation at the Rhythmic Music Conservatory. Katrín spent half a year in Cornwall as an exchange student at Falmouth University, studying Creative Music Technology in the autumn of 2018. After picking up the electric bass in 2018, she has released 4 solo albums in Icelandic and English, which can be found on Spotify and bandcamp. Recently she started writing songs on guitar, and will play some of those in Icelandic and English.

SIRENS Studio is offering 2 music/sound based residency opportunities in association with Fish Factory Arts for 1 week each (with additional days optional) in February & April 2023. Dates included below:
1st Feb 2023 - 8th Feb 2023
8th Feb 2023 - 15th Feb 2023
1st April 2023 - 7th April 2023
8th April 2023 - 14th April 2023

These residencies are aimed at anyone who identifies as a marginalised gender. SIRENS Studio is a community based project that acknowledges the difficulties that diverse genders have in the music industry, specifically recording studios. The residencies are restricted to people aged 18-25 due to being funded by Youth Music’s Incubator fund for young people. Please only apply if you fit this criteria. (This is also open to duos or bands).

During the residency you will have access to the following spaces:
- SIRENS Studio - recording studio with access to a sound engineer for 12 hours total, the space is available for 24/7 unsupervised practice and recording for the full week (we will give you a short induction to the space at the beginning of your stay)
- Opportunity to do a gig in the performance space at Fish Factory Arts
- Accommodation in the Little Fish Studios residency room, with kitchen and toilet (showering facilities down the road next to SIRENS Studio). Please note this is on the first floor and not suitable for people with mobility needs - other accommodation may be arranged

We have workshop spaces available, so during your stay there is the opportunity of running an informal free workshop for members of the community. This is not a requirement but we would love to know a skill you have that you can pass on to the community.

You will be paid £800 to include expenses and travel cost.

Sirens Studio are excited to begin hiring for the second year of their funded project!

Sirens are looking for people interested in studio engineering, production or songwriting to help record and facilitate the production of our artists in residence in spring and summer 2023. Placement includes 24 hours of paid work in our little studio on the Quay over the course of 1 week (flexibility will be required throughout the week), working with ourselves and one of our specially selected residency artists. No experience is necessary as all training is included. You must be within commutable distance of Penryn.

Placement will include:
(If required)
- Induction on equipment
- Training on mic placement and recording techniques
- Introduction to software
- Multiple recording sessions
- Opportunity for creative input at each stage

Sirens is a community based recording studio which aims to encourage self-production and DIY recording. This role could be ideal for an experienced engineer who would simply enjoy helping out women, trans and non-binary DIY musicians, but also someone with little to no experience who would like to begin learning how to record and produce independently.
